MEMORANDUM OPINION AND ORDER re: 11 Motion to Dismiss filed by Glenn S. Goord,, H. Carl McCall,, Eliot L. Spitzer,, 14 Motion to Dismiss filed by MCI Telecommunications Corporation,, MCI Worldcom, Inc.,. State defendants' motion to dismiss plaintiffs' claims challenging the exclusive services contract between the state and MCI is granted. State defendants' motion to dismiss plaintiffs' claims alleging the collect-call only system is granted. The state defendants' motion to dismiss plaintiffs' claims challenging the 60% commission is denied. Defendant MCI's motion to dismiss is granted in its entirety (Signed by Judge George B. Daniels on 8/26/05) (yv, ) Modified on 8/29/2005 (yv, ). (Entered: 08/29/2005)
